Handover for the Bramleyfort password reset revamp. The new flow replaces emailed links with short-lived codes; rate limiting lives in ResetGate middleware, and token hashing moved to the Larkspur helper. Tests cover expiry, reuse, and enumeration. Outstanding: the audit-log event names need review before merge, and the staging feature flag is still off. To unlock the shared credentials vault for the staging run, the recovery passphrase is below.

vault phrase of yadup-hahog = kasax-goriel-olidor-novmir-istax-olimir-sorys-olimir-holeth-aldeth-ralax-zordor-ralion-wenax

Effective next quarter, Bramhall Systems moves from flat-rate commissions to a tiered model. Deals under the base threshold pay 4%; mid-tier deals pay 6%; strategic accounts pay 8% plus a renewal bonus. Accelerators apply once a rep exceeds 110% of quota. Draws are discontinued for tenured staff. Heads of department should brief their teams on mechanics only, not rationale. Payout timing shifts to monthly reconciliation under the Ledgerline tool. The rationale ties directly to the confidential plan noted below.

board note of kawig-tawif: Project Julmir slips by two quarters because of the supplier delay.

## Restock Planner API

The FillCycle planner figures out which vending machines need topping up and spits out a route for the morning run. You'll mostly hit `/v2/plan` and `/v2/machines/{id}/levels`. Both endpoints sit behind the internal Coinbox gateway, so every request needs a key in the `X-Fillcycle-Key` header — no key, no plan, and the drivers will let you know about it. For quick curl checks during an incident, use this one.

app token of bahaf-tajeg = zpat23_SjjsllwiLmXbtS65veZaV47